How to choose a home energy storage battery?

For those considering purchasing a home energy storage battery, the following factors should be carefully evaluated: Battery Type: Choose between LiFePO₄ (safer, longer lifespan) and NMC (higher energy density). Cycle Life and Warranty: Look for batteries with at least 6,000 cycles and strong warranties.

Which countries offer a solar battery storage program?

Germany’s KfW Battery Storage Program provides financial support for homeowners installing solar battery systems. California’s SGIP (Self-Generation Incentive Program) offers rebates to reduce battery costs for homeowners. In the UK, battery storage can qualify for VAT reductions when installed alongside solar panels.

What are the key developments in the energy industry?

Key developments include: The European Union’s Green Deal aims for carbon neutrality by 2050, with generous incentives for solar and battery storage. The United States’ Inflation Reduction Act (IRA) provides tax credits for home energy storage systems, increasing affordability.
